At the University of California Medical Centre at Davis (U.S.A.), researchers concluded that Yog Nidra is applicable for bedridden, incapacitated and chronically affected patients of all degrees. They report that yog nidra can improve the lives of these patients in several distinct ways by:-
• Reliving insomnia,
• Sleep disturbances,
• Depression,
• Decreasing the requirements for analgesic, hypnotic and sedative drugs .
The ability of Yog Nidra to control the pain was investigated in a study at the Pittsburgh (U.S.A.), in which the need for analgesic medication was eliminated or markedly reduced among the 54 patients participating in the study. They suffered from headaches of either migraines muscular or tension types, a variety of conditions characterized by long term or intermittent pain (peptic ulcer syndrome), shoulder and neck pain ( sodalities syndrome) and lower back pain ( slip disc syndrome). At follow up after six weeks of Yog Nidra therapy, patients reported an average of 81% effective pain relief.

Stress has increasingly become associated with greater susceptibility to various illnesses. The condition is also costly from an economic and financial perspective, but such costs hardly reflect the human costs of emotional trauma and physical suffering that result from the illness. Women today are in a situation where both the monetary and human effects of stress take their toll as women face unprecedented pressures in accommodating the demands of home and career and personal family stresses that often result. In addition to this, while women are prone to the same stressors as men, they are confronted with potentially unique physical and psychological stressors of their own. They may also become stress "carriers" as in the abusive husband and unfair boss relationship. Ironically, despite these differences women live longer than men, although collectively they are reported to have more symptoms, illnesses, intake of drugs and doctor-hospital visits.
